India's Commitment to Climate Resilience and Adaptation
2026-05-18
Background: India has consistently emphasized the need for climate resilience and adaptation measures to mitigate the impacts of climate change. The country is vulnerable to extreme weather events and rising sea levels. Current Context: Recent reports highlight India's ongoing efforts in developing and implementing adaptation strategies across various sectors, including agriculture, water management, and coastal protection. The National Action Plan on Climate Change (NAPCC) and its associated missions continue to guide these initiatives. Impact: These efforts aim to reduce the vulnerability of Indian communities and ecosystems to climate change, enhance adaptive capacity, and promote sustainable development pathways that are resilient to climate shocks.
Expansion of Protected Areas for Biodiversity Conservation

Background: India is a megadiverse country with a rich variety of flora and fauna. Protecting these natural habitats is crucial for maintaining ecological balance and preserving biodiversity. Current Context: The Ministry of Environment, Forest and Climate Change is actively working on expanding the network of protected areas, including national parks, wildlife sanctuaries, and conservation reserves. Recent proposals and declarations focus on critical wildlife corridors and ecologically sensitive zones. Impact: The expansion of protected areas will provide safe havens for endangered species, prevent habitat fragmentation, and contribute to the long-term conservation of India's unique biodiversity, supporting ecosystem services.
Initiatives for Wetland Conservation and Ramsar Sites

Background: Wetlands are vital ecosystems that provide numerous ecological and economic benefits, including water purification, flood control, and supporting rich biodiversity. India has a significant number of wetland ecosystems. Current Context: India is actively participating in global efforts to conserve wetlands, as evidenced by its increasing number of Ramsar sites. The government is implementing the National Wetland Conservation Programme (NWCP) and promoting community-based conservation approaches. Impact: These conservation efforts aim to protect and restore the ecological character of wetlands, enhance their biodiversity, and ensure the sustainable use of wetland resources for the benefit of local communities and the environment.
